+ // Overriding the queue:
+ // ThreadPoolExecutor would not create new threads if the queue is not full, thus adding
+ // occurs in RejectedExecutionHandler.
+ // This impl saturates threadpool first, then queue. When both are full caller will get blocked.
+ BlockingQueue<Runnable> queue = new LinkedBlockingQueue<Runnable>(MAX_NOTIFICATION_QUEUE_SIZE) {
+ @Override
+ public boolean offer(Runnable r) {
+ // ThreadPoolExecutor will spawn a new thread after core size is reached only if the queue.offer returns false.
+ return false;
+ }
+ };
+
+ ThreadFactory factory = new ThreadFactoryBuilder().setDaemon(true).setNameFormat("md-sal-binding-notification-%d").build();
+
+ ThreadPoolExecutor executor = new ThreadPoolExecutor(CORE_NOTIFICATION_THREADS, MAX_NOTIFICATION_THREADS,
+ NOTIFICATION_THREAD_LIFE, TimeUnit.SECONDS, queue , factory,
+ new RejectedExecutionHandler() {
+ // if the max threads are met, then it will raise a rejectedExecution. We then push to the queue.
+ @Override
+ public void rejectedExecution(Runnable r, ThreadPoolExecutor executor) {
+ try {
+ executor.getQueue().put(r);
+ } catch (InterruptedException e) {
+ Thread.currentThread().interrupt();// set interrupt flag after clearing
+ throw new IllegalStateException(e);
+ }
+ }
+ });
+
+ NOTIFICATION_EXECUTOR = MoreExecutors.listeningDecorator(executor);
